Find a Lawyer in Morocco CityAbout Social Security Law in Morocco City, United States
Social Security is a federal program that provides financial assistance to people with insufficient or no income, primarily through retirement, disability, and survivors benefits. In Morocco City, United States, residents are entitled to access this program under the broader jurisdiction of federal regulations. The Social Security Administration (SSA) oversees these benefits and administers them according to federal laws. However, local legal interpretations and applications can affect how these benefits are accessed and received by residents.
Why You May Need a Lawyer
There are several situations where individuals might need legal help with Social Security in Morocco City:
- Denial of Benefits: If your application for Social Security benefits has been denied, a lawyer can help you appeal the decision effectively.
- Overpayment Issues: If you have been accused of receiving an overpayment, legal assistance can help you navigate repayment or waiver requests.
- Disability Claims: Understanding complex medical requirements and legal terminology can be challenging without professional help.
- Fraud or Misconduct Accusations: Facing accusations of fraud can have serious consequences; a lawyer can aid in defending your rights.
- Update or Review of Benefits: Life changes like marriage, divorce, or employment status can impact your benefit amounts and eligibility.

Frequently Asked Questions
What are the basic eligibility requirements for Social Security benefits?
Eligibility generally depends on factors such as age, work history, and disability status. For retirement benefits, you need a certain number of years of work credits.
How do I apply for Social Security benefits?
You can apply online on the SSA website, in person at a local SSA office, or over the phone.
What should I do if my Social Security application is denied?
You can appeal the denial within 60 days. Consulting with a lawyer can increase your chances of a successful appeal.
Are my Social Security benefits taxable?
Yes, they can be subject to federal income tax depending on your total income level. State tax rules may vary.
Can I work while receiving Social Security Disability benefits?
Yes, but there are limitations. You need to stay under certain earning thresholds to continue receiving full benefits.
How long should I expect the Social Security application process to take?
The process can take several months. Disability claims, in particular, may take longer due to the need for extensive documentation.
What is the process for appealing a Social Security decision?
The appeal process involves several levels: reconsideration, a hearing before an administrative law judge, an Appeals Council review, and finally federal court, if necessary.
Do Social Security benefits change if I move out of Morocco City?
Your basic benefits won't change due to relocation, but local regulations and assistance programs might be different.
How are survivor benefits calculated?
Survivor benefits are based on the earnings of the deceased. The more they paid into Social Security, the higher the benefits will be.
Can I receive both Social Security retirement and disability benefits?
Typically, no. Once you reach full retirement age, disability benefits convert to retirement benefits at the same rate.
